520 |a Leaders seeking to advance diversity, equity, and inclusion in their organization need approaches that frame DEI as an opportunity and provide an avenue for all members to meaningfully engage in it. The authors advocate a new approach based on research into organizations making meaningful progress in DEI: the Values/Principles Model, or VPM. It is based on cultivating four values -- representation, participation, application, and appreciation -- along with seven guiding principles.
